Are you using DELL S2722QC 4k monitor? You inputs are much appreciated regarding flickering issue.

I'm using a Dell S2722QC monitor with a base M4 Mac Mini -- don't have any flickering issues. I did not use the USB-C cable that came with the monitor (Dell 5K50313501) -- I bought the OWC TB4 28in cable and used the mac mini's rear TB4 port to monitor's USB-C port.
